Chromium, Hexavalent in Brown Deer, WI tap water
Brown Deer, WI's 2023 report shows Chromium, Hexavalent detected, but the EPA has not set an enforceable federal limit for it.
The measurement
| Statistic | Value | Federal limit |
|---|---|---|
Range Range or | 0.13–0.18 ug/L | None set |
Average System-wide | 0.15 ug/L | None set |

About Chromium, Hexavalent
Hexavalent chromium ('chromium-6') — the more toxic form of chromium.
A known carcinogen by inhalation; regulated nationally only within the total-chromium limit, with stricter limits in some states.
